The Midvale Arts Council will present “Bye Bye Birdie” July 9-23 (Fridays, Saturdays, & Mondays) at 7:30 p.m. at the Midvale Outdoor Stage in the Park, 400 West 7500 South. This story, set in the 1950s, shows rock star Conrad Birdie who has just been called up to the Army. Before he leaves he will visit Sweet Apple, Ohio to give Sweet Apple’s own Kim MacAfee ‘One Last Kiss.’ “Bye Bye Birdie” is a wholesome, energetic show sure to be a family favorite. The show is directed by Michelle Groves, with music direction by Marla Hintze, and choreography by Elise Groves. The cast includes Jeremiah Wing as Albert, Rebekah Hintze as Rosie, Danny James as Conrad Birdie, Larissa Villers as Kim, JaNae Cottam as Mae, and Tim & Joanne Frost as the MacAfees.
